Cursive Nemom 10 is a light, normal width, low contrast, reverse italic, short x-height font.

This font has a monoline, pen-drawn look with softly rounded turns and gently tapered terminals. Letterforms lean subtly backward, with a relaxed baseline rhythm and slightly varying character widths that give it an organic, handwritten pacing. Curves dominate, with frequent loops in descenders and joining strokes, while capitals remain simple and open rather than highly ornamented. Counters are generous and shapes stay smooth and continuous, producing an overall light, sketch-like texture in text.

It suits short to medium-length settings where a personal, hand-lettered voice is desired, such as invitations, greeting cards, packaging accents, social media graphics, and quote treatments. It can also work for headings or callouts where a casual script adds warmth and approachability.

The tone feels informal and approachable, like quick but careful handwriting on a note or label. Its looping forms and easy rhythm read as friendly and lightly whimsical, adding personality without becoming overly decorative. The backward slant and airy construction contribute to a laid-back, conversational feel.

The design appears intended to mimic everyday cursive writing with a clean, continuous stroke and relaxed back-slanted motion. Its goal is to provide an easygoing handwritten signature for display and casual text, emphasizing natural flow, loops, and friendly legibility over strict typographic regularity.

In the sample text, word shapes stay consistent and readable, with clear differentiation between many letters through distinctive loops and long descenders. Spacing appears naturally uneven in a hand-written way, which reinforces the personal character and keeps lines from feeling rigid or mechanical.
